
数据结构
y12345op
这个作者很懒,什么都没留下…
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
数据结构Day02-栈、队列
栈一种特殊的线性表,只允许在一端进行输入输出,规则为LIFO;package day02;public class Stack { int elements[]; public Stack(){ elements=new int[0]; } //插入元素,总是放在最后 public void push(int element){ int [] newArr=new int[elements.length+1]; //把原数组中的元素复制到新的数组 for(int i=0;i原创 2022-01-04 16:19:46 · 237 阅读 · 0 评论 -
数据结构Day02-查找算法
线性查找public class Search { public static void main(String[] args){ //目标数组 int[] arr=new int[]{1,2,3,4,5,6,7,9}; //目标元素 int target=3; //目标元素所在下标 int index=-1; //遍历数组 for(int i=0;i<arr.length;i++){ if(arr[i]==target){ index=i;原创 2022-01-04 15:07:46 · 261 阅读 · 0 评论 -
数据结构01
数据结构学习原创 2022-01-03 15:43:06 · 154 阅读 · 0 评论 -
数据结构--数组
1.数组基本使用public class Array1 { public static void main(String[] args){ //创建一个数组 int[] arr=new int[10]; //获取数组长度 int length=arr.length; System.out.println(length);//10 //访问数组当中的元素 :数组名[下标],注意从0开始,最大取到length-1; System.out.println("element "+a原创 2022-01-03 17:13:26 · 635 阅读 · 0 评论